I’ve spent over two decades crawling through attics, cramming myself into mechanical rooms, and setting equipment in spaces were “level” isn’t just a suggestion—it’s the difference between a system that runs efficiently for fifteen years and one that fails in three. In HVAC work, precision matters. A condenser pad that’s off by even a couple degrees can cause compressor oil migration issues. Drain lines without proper pitch will back up and flood a ceiling.Ductwork installed at the wrong angle creates airflow restrictions that kill your static pressure and tank your system efficiency.
That’s why I’ve always kept a quality level in my bag, right alongside my manifold gauges and refrigerant scale. Traditional bubble levels work, but they have limitations—especially when you’re trying to hit exact pitches on condensate lines or need repeatable angles for multiple runs of lineset. I’ve watched newer techs struggle with eyeballing 1/4-inch per foot pitch, only to get callbacks for standing water in drain pans.

Precision and Accuracy in real World HVAC Applications

When I’m setting refrigerant line sets or positioning condensate drains on a heat pump install, the difference between a properly pitched line and one that’s off by even a degree can mean the difference between smooth operation and costly callbacks. This digital level has become my go-to for line set pitching, especially when I need that precise 1/4-inch per foot slope for proper oil return on R-410A systems or the newer R-32 installations. The programmable target angles with audible alarm mean I can set my pitch and keep my eyes on the work instead of constantly checking the bubble. I’ve used it extensively when installing mini-split line sets where even slight deviations can affect efficiency ratings, and the dual-axis bullseye mode has been invaluable for leveling outdoor condenser pads on uneven ground—critical when you’re working with high-SEER units where vibration and noise output are customer concerns. The magnetic V-groove base grips securely to copper line sets and electrical conduit, which is essential when you’re working solo on a rooftop install in less-than-ideal conditions.
The auto-rotating display and high-contrast screen have proven their worth in dimly lit crawl spaces and attics where I’m often routing ductwork or checking the pitch on condensate lines from high-efficiency furnaces and air handlers. Traditional bubble levels simply don’t cut it when you need repeatable accuracy across multiple zones or when verifying that supply plenums are level before calculating proper airflow distribution for a balanced system. I’ve also found the 0-180 degree range particularly useful when setting angles on custom sheet metal transitions or verifying the pitch on gravity-fed drain lines from evaporator coils—situations where a tenth of a degree matters for preventing water backup and potential filter damage from overflow. The tool has held up through hundreds of installs, from residential split systems to light commercial RTUs, maintaining calibration better than other digital levels I’ve cycled through over the years.

| Application | Recommended Setting | Field benefit |
|---|---|---|
| Suction Line Pitch | 1/4″ per foot | Prevents oil trapping, ensures compressor lubrication |
| Condensate Drain | 1/8″ to 1/4″ per foot | Eliminates standing water and overflow issues |
| Mini-Split Head Mounting | bullseye Level (X/Y axis) | Reduces vibration and improves condensate drainage |
| Outdoor Unit Pad | 0° (Level) | Maintains compressor oil distribution and warranty compliance |
| Gas Piping Runs | Custom angle or 1/4″ pitch | Prevents condensation pooling in gas lines |
